Hi all!

Greeting from Ireland (South).
Very similar to Martinpp, I've been wanting and looking for an PZ for quite some time.
With little money to spend I finally picked up one in the UK (obviously! where else were they sold) at a rock bottom price, unseen.

Info:
2007 73k Cat D, It's black, paint work is in decent condition, starts first go (hot and cold) and it appears to be driving ok.

I began soon minor maintenance:
- oil change
- knocked the cat out (it was blocked and making the seat rails rather hot)
- got it up on a ramp and oh dear...

2021 Project:
a) Rust - replace sills, patch work around arches and tidy up the subframe
b) Exhaust - with the cat removed there is still significant heat on the seat rails. Pulled about 4ft of hair from the exhaust so reckon the muffler/silencer is bust. Strong small of petrol too from the rear
c) The Big ouch! - both rear coil springs cracked. Need to a whole heap of web searching to find replacements.
If anyone here has thoughts on replacement options it would be much appreciated e.g.
- could I get normal Eilbach RX8 springs and hope they "do the job"
- would Prodrive give advise on where to source a replica pair (the 60% extra stiffness)?
d) Recondition the alloys

2022 Project:
Sort out the mechanicals
a) Overhaul ignition system and likely Engine rebuild
b) Enjoy it

Looking forward to learning more here and moving forward with my project. This car is a keeper.

Post by Markl17 »

Welcome to the club,it’s a great place to be.
I think you need to find pz springs as this was one of the main differences,if you put something else on it become the same as all the rest.,rust is starting to be the main killer of the rx8.
